Below is a table outlining the critical elements that ensure the security and integrity of online casino games, demonstrating why the concept of “hacking” them is a myth:

Aspect of Security Description & Impact Official Reference/Example
Random Number Generators (RNGs) Sophisticated algorithms ensuring unpredictable and fair game outcomes, independently audited for randomness․ Essential for game integrity․ eCOGRA Certification
Advanced Encryption (SSL/TLS) Protects all data transmissions between the player and the casino, safeguarding personal and financial information from interception․ DigiCert SSL/TLS Information
Regulatory Licensing & Audits Casinos operate under strict licenses from reputable authorities (e․g․, MGA, UKGC), undergoing regular audits for fairness, security, and responsible gaming․ Malta Gaming Authority (MGA)
Fraud Detection & AI Monitoring Leveraging AI and machine learning to identify suspicious patterns, prevent account takeovers, and detect fraudulent activities in real-time․ FICO Fraud & Security Solutions
Secure Payment Gateways Integration with trusted, PCI DSS compliant payment processors, ensuring secure and encrypted transactions without exposing sensitive details to the casino itself․ PCI Security Standards Council

The digital fortress protecting online casinos is remarkably effective, operating on multiple layers to ensure a seamless yet secure gaming environment․ At the core of every reputable online casino game lies the Random Number Generator (RNG), a sophisticated algorithm that meticulously produces billions of unpredictable outcomes per second․ This isn’t some easily decipherable code; it’s a cryptographic marvel, independently tested and certified by third-party auditors like eCOGRA and iTech Labs to guarantee absolute fairness and randomness․ Therefore, any attempt at predicting or manipulating game results is thwarted by the very essence of how these games are designed, leaving no room for human intervention or external influence․

Beyond the games themselves, the entire infrastructure of an online casino is meticulously guarded․ Robust SSL/TLS encryption protocols, similar to those used by leading financial institutions, encrypt every byte of data exchanged, from your login credentials to your banking information․ This creates an impenetrable tunnel, safeguarding personal details from prying eyes and ensuring that every transaction is conducted with the utmost confidentiality․ Furthermore, sophisticated firewalls, intrusion detection systems, and real-time monitoring by dedicated cybersecurity teams work tirelessly around the clock, acting as a vigilant digital sentry, constantly scanning for and neutralizing potential threats before they can even materialize․ The industry’s proactive stance on security is not just about protection; it’s about building enduring trust with players globally․

Moreover, the regulatory framework governing online casinos adds an essential layer of oversight and accountability․ Esteemed licensing bodies, such as the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) and the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C), impose stringent requirements on operators, covering everything from financial stability and fair gaming practices to responsible advertising and data protection․ These bodies conduct regular audits and enforce strict compliance, ensuring that casinos adhere to the highest standards of integrity․ Choosing a licensed and regulated casino isn’t just a recommendation; it’s a critical step in guaranteeing a safe, fair, and enjoyable gaming experience, knowing that your interests are protected by robust legal and ethical guidelines․
